Transaction de60db7ce0d288066715eb38f8e469c76b60133519025400705d6fddc3d7a5f3
1 Input
1 Output
-
de60db7ce0d288066715eb38f8e469c76b60133519025400705d6fddc3d7a5f3:0
- value
- 507926
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 63dc18d3d50e911b1ca75a26d6db8db0d54e07a8dc286575b142df1890e64a0b
- address
- tb1pv0wp3574p6g3k898tgnddkudkr25upagms5x2ad3gt033y8xfg9s4mwnm3